What exactly is Amazon building with $13 billion?
Amazon just announced that it will invest 20 billion Australian dollars—about $13 billion USD—into expanding its data center operations in Australia by 2029.

According to the company, this is its biggest investment in the country yet, and the largest public tech investment ever made in Australia.

A quick explainer on cloud computing and why this investment matters
At the heart of Amazon’s data center expansion is cloud computing. Think of it like renting computing power instead of buying it. Instead of owning their own servers, companies can “rent” access to Amazon’s infrastructure through its cloud platform, AWS (Amazon Web Services).
With the rise of AI, the demand for cloud services has exploded. Startups, governments, and global corporations all need serious computing power to run AI models—and they’re turning to cloud providers to get it.
Amazon’s investment doesn’t just include the data centers themselves. The company is also building three solar farms to power these energy-hungry operations, signaling a commitment to sustainability as it scales up.
Why Australia and why now?
Australia is a strategic location. It’s close to major Asia-Pacific markets, politically stable, and has reliable infrastructure. It’s also a market where Amazon sees long-term growth potential.
The Australian government is clearly thrilled. Prime Minister Anthony Albanese called the move a “huge vote of confidence” in the country’s economy, saying it will help boost productivity and future-proof the nation’s digital capabilities.
This is part of a much bigger global arms race
Zoom out a bit, and you’ll see this is just one piece of a global expansion strategy.
In the past few weeks alone, Amazon has announced plans to spend $20 billion in Pennsylvania and another $10 billion in North Carolina to grow its AI infrastructure in the U.S. It’s also eyeing new cloud regions in Chile, New Zealand, and Saudi Arabia.
Its rivals are in the same race. Microsoft is investing billions in its AI-powered cloud, especially through its partnership with OpenAI. Google is ramping up data center capacity and even building its own AI chips.
